Story summary
- The Empowered Communities program, a collaboration between George Mason University and local organizations, aims to improve health care access for underserved populations in Prince William County, Virginia.
- The program’s Opioid Project connects justice-involved individuals with health services to address opioid-related needs.
- In Missoula, Montana, the Watershed Navigation Center supports individuals exiting incarceration by providing resources to prevent recidivism and assisting them in securing housing and employment.
